It equips leaders with thought-provoking questions to evaluate their organization’s readiness for the digital age, such as whether their risk culture enables digital advancement or hinders progress. With a focus on maximizing upside potential and mitigating downside risks, it encourages organizations to embrace forward-looking strategies that balance agility and resilience.
Sample questions include:
- Is the organization's risk culture enabling its advancement in digital maturity?
- Does the board possess the digital savviness to provide the leadership the company needs and support the CEO?
- Has the board determined that management understands the digital economy and is embracing the appropriate market differentiation possibilities in the company's strategic thinking?
